Transaction 843f098121d7552e88e18787ea377d6769b916ea24206e02ac7af295e6ed77f5
1 Input
1 Output
-
843f098121d7552e88e18787ea377d6769b916ea24206e02ac7af295e6ed77f5:0
- value
- 730504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 829b9589d61d3cdc8d8aa06d5520f9e7e13f1b05 OP_EQUAL
- address
- 3Dbc9f422wpVK7VDQUQZTVkTQbyvrsXW29